Songwriter Dean Dillon Honored by Hall of Fame
Dean Dillon is to be honored by the Country Music Hall of Fame.
He will be the next subject of the quarterly series, Poets and Prophets: Legendary Country Songwriters.
Dillon will be interviewed and give a performance in the museum’s Ford Theater on November 1st.
Dillon has written or co-written many No. 1 songs for George Strait including, “The Chair”, “Nobody in His Right Mind Would’ve Left Her”, “It Ain’t Cool to Be Crazy About You”, “Ocean Front Property”, “Famous Last Words of a Fool”, “I’ve Come to Expect It From You”, “If I Know Me”, “Easy Come Easy Go”, “The Best Day” and “She Let Herself Go”.
Dillon’s many other writing credits include “Tennessee Whiskey” (sung by George Jones), “Homecoming ‘63″ (sung by Keith Whitley), “Set ‘Em Up Joe” (sung by Vern Gosdin), “All the Good Ones Are Gone” (sung by Pam Tillis), “A Lot of Things Different” (sung by Kenny Chesney ) and “A Little Too Late” (sung by Toby Keith).
Trace Adkins & Lynyrd Skynyrd Perform In Two Cities On New Year’s Eve
It’s a Tale Of Two Cities for Trace Adkins & Lynyrd Skynyrd this New Year’s Eve.
Both will be performing at New Year’s Eve concerts in both Nashville and Pikeville, Kentucky later this year. The cities are in different time zones.
Trace Adkins will be starting his performance at the Sommet Center in Nashville and will then fly to Pikeville to close the show there.
Lynyrd Skynyrd will be opening at the Eastern Kentucky Expo in Pikeville. He will then fly to Nashville to close the Sommet Center concert.
Tickets will go on sale on October 18th.
Rascal Flatts Perform At Nashville Children’s Hopsital
The Rascal Flatts hosted a party for the patients at the Monroe Carell Jr Children’s Hospital in Vanderbilt, Nashville on Thursday.
The Flatts performed for the children and their families and with the help our their record company, Lyric Street (who are owned by Disney) were able to bring along several Disney characters including Mickey & Minnie Mouse and Cinderella and Snow White.
The Flatts performed “Fast Cars and Freedom”, “What Hurts the Most” and other songs and then visited other children in the hospital who were unable to attend the party.
The Rascal Flatts will perform at the annual benefit concert for the hospital on October 17th at Nashville’s Sommet Center.
The Flatts have already helped raise more than $2.2 million for the hospital over the past three years.

Brad Paisley’s New Album “Play” Out November 4th
Brad Paisley is changing things with the release of his next album “Play”.
The new album is a mostly instrumental project that focuses on Paisley’s love of the guitar.
While the new album may be focused on his skills as a musician it certainly doesn’t stop him singing. There are several tracks featuring Paisley’s vocals as well as the vocals of Keith Urban, Steve Wariner and the late Buck Owens.
Paisley says, “The last thing people want to hear is stuff that you have to have a music degree to enjoy”, and added “We made this record a little more relatable and commercial than expected”.
Brad’s hoping that “Play” will connect with his audience despite its different approach.
“It is my love affair with this instrument. Hopefully, we won’t lose momentum with this record. If we do, then I’ll just have to work twice as hard to get it back, but it’s worth the risk because it’s such a labor of love for me”.
“Play” from Brad Paisley comes out on November 4th.
LeAnn Rimes Postpones More Shows
It appears that LeAnn Rimes is having more problems performing due to illness.
Rimes has postponed two concerts that were originally scheduled for this weekend. She was scheduled to perform in Norfolk, Virginia on Friday and in Charleston, West Virginia on Saturday.
According to her official website Leann Rimes World, her doctor has ordered additional vocal rest.
Rime’s website also says she will resume her touring schedule on October 17th in Lake Charles, Louisiana.
Rimes has already had to cancel several dates due to vocal illness this year including two in May, two in August and two in September.

New Releases From Tim McGraw & George Strait
Tim McGraw releases his “Greatest Hits 3″ today and George Strait releases his “Classic Christmas” album.
McGraw’s album includes 12 songs including “If You’re Reading This” plus a live version of “Real Good Man”. His recent collaborations with Tracy Lawrence and Def Leppard are also included on the album.
Strait’s holiday album is a re-issue of Fresh Cut Christmas which Strait released exclusively through Hallmark Gold Crown Stores in 2006.
Selections include “We Three Kings”, “Up on the Housetop”, “Hark the Herald Angels Sing”, “Deck the Halls”, “O Come All Ye Faithful” and “We Wish You a Merry Christmas”.
